📖 Body Language: The Silent Communicator

Dogs primarily use body language to express themselves. Key indicators include:

  • Tail Position: A wagging tail often indicates happiness, while a tucked tail can signify fear or submission. 🐕
  • Ears: Erect ears show alertness; flattened ears may indicate anxiety or aggression. 👂
  • Eyes: Direct eye contact can be a challenge, while averting gaze shows submission. 👀
  • Posture: A relaxed body suggests comfort; a stiff stance may signal tension. 🐾

🔊 Vocalizations: Expressing Emotions

Dogs use various sounds to communicate:

  • Barking: Can indicate excitement, alertness, or a call for attention. 🗣️
  • Whining: Often a sign of distress, anxiety, or desire. 😢
  • Growling: A warning to back off or a sign of discomfort. ⚠️
  • Howling: May express loneliness or respond to certain sounds. 🎶

👃 Scent Communication: The Invisible Messages

Dogs have a keen sense of smell and use it to gather information:

  • Sniffing: Helps them learn about other animals and their environment. 👃
  • Urine Marking: Communicates territory boundaries and reproductive status. 🚻
  • Glandular Secretions: Provide unique scents for identification. 🧴

🤝 Enhancing Human-Dog Communication

To build a stronger bond with your dog:

  • Observe: Pay attention to your dog's body language and sounds. 👀
  • Respond Appropriately: Acknowledge their signals and provide comfort or space as needed. 🤗
  • Consistent Training: Use positive reinforcement to encourage desired behaviors. 🎓
  • Consult Professionals: Seek guidance from veterinarians or trainers for specific concerns. 🩺
